1. No Lentils? No Problem!

The Unexpected Twist: Believe it or not, you can create a "lentil-like" soup without using lentils!

The Clever Workaround: Use other legumes like split peas, or even a mix of beans (kidney, pinto, etc.) for a similar texture and nutritional profile. The earthy flavor won't be exactly the same, but the result will still be a hearty and flavorful soup. Remember to adjust cooking time according to the legume you choose.

2. Running Low on Time? Speed Up the Process!

The Time Crunch: Who has hours to spend simmering soup?

The Clever Workaround: Use pre-cooked lentils (found in most grocery stores). This significantly reduces cooking time, allowing you to whip up a delicious soup in a fraction of the usual time. You'll still need to sauté your vegetables and simmer the soup to blend the flavors, but the lentils themselves will be ready to go!

3. Missing Key Vegetables? Improvise!

The Missing Ingredient: Sometimes, the grocery store doesn't cooperate, and you're missing a key vegetable for your lentil soup recipe.

The Clever Workaround: Don't panic! Lentil soup is incredibly versatile. If you lack carrots, substitute with sweet potatoes or parsnips for sweetness. Missing celery? A little extra onion or a dash of celery seed can add similar notes. Experiment and don't be afraid to adjust the recipe to your available ingredients!

4. Boosting Flavor Without Extra Ingredients

The Flavor Enhancement: Want to elevate your lentil soup's taste profile without adding a long list of spices?

The Clever Workaround: Use flavorful broth! Vegetable broth is standard, but try a richer broth like chicken or beef (for a heartier soup) or even mushroom broth for an umami boost. A simple squeeze of lemon juice or a splash of red wine vinegar at the end can brighten up the flavors beautifully. Don't underestimate the power of a good quality broth!

Tips for the Perfect Lentil Soup (Regardless of Workarounds)

  • Sauté your vegetables: This step adds depth of flavor that you can't achieve by simply throwing everything into the pot.
  • Don't overcook your lentils: Overcooked lentils can become mushy. Follow package instructions carefully or use a quick-cooking method.
  • Season to taste: Taste your soup throughout the cooking process and adjust seasoning accordingly. Salt, pepper, and herbs are your best friends!
  • Garnish generously: Fresh herbs like parsley or cilantro, a dollop of plain yogurt or sour cream, and a drizzle of olive oil can elevate your soup's presentation and taste.
